The Karate Kid's Enduring Legacy

The original Karate Kid films, released in the 1980s, weren't just box office successes; they became cultural touchstones. Their themes of perseverance, mentorship under the wise Mr. Miyagi, and the transformative power of self-discovery struck a chord with audiences of all ages. The movies' impact is undeniable:

  • Iconic Characters: Daniel LaRusso, Johnny Lawrence, and the unforgettable Mr. Miyagi are instantly recognizable figures, ingrained in popular culture. Their complex relationships and personal journeys continue to fascinate viewers.
  • Lasting Popularity and Cultural References: Phrases like "Wax on, wax off" have entered the lexicon, becoming synonymous with perseverance and hidden wisdom. The films' influence can be seen in countless movies, TV shows, and even memes.
  • Box Office Success and Critical Acclaim: The original Karate Kid films were massive commercial successes, earning critical praise and solidifying their place in cinematic history. Their impact extends far beyond their initial release, with repeated viewings across generations.

Cobra Kai's Resurgence and Netflix's Role

Cobra Kai, initially released on YouTube, cleverly re-imagined the Karate Kid universe, revisiting the rivalry between Daniel LaRusso and Johnny Lawrence decades later. However, it was its move to Netflix that truly catapulted the show to global recognition. Netflix's massive reach and powerful marketing machine played a crucial role in its success:

  • Wider Audience Reach: Netflix provided Cobra Kai with unprecedented access to a global audience, transcending geographical boundaries and introducing the show to millions of new viewers.
  • Impact of Netflix's Marketing and Distribution: Netflix's sophisticated marketing strategies, including targeted advertising and algorithmic recommendations, ensured that Cobra Kai reached its intended demographic and beyond.
  • Success Metrics: The show's phenomenal success is evident in its consistently high viewership numbers, critical acclaim, and numerous award nominations, further cementing its status as a cultural phenomenon.

Expanding the Karate Kid Universe

Cobra Kai doesn't simply rehash the original story; it expands the Karate Kid universe in exciting and meaningful ways. The show delves deeper into the characters, explores new storylines, and introduces compelling new characters, all while remaining true to the spirit of the originals:

  • Complex Character Development: Johnny Lawrence's redemption arc is a particular highlight, showcasing the show's ability to explore nuanced morality and provide compelling character growth.
  • New Generations of Karate Students: The introduction of new karate students adds fresh perspectives and expands the universe beyond the original characters, ensuring longevity and appeal to new audiences.
  • Exploration of Broader Themes: Cobra Kai tackles themes beyond karate, including family dynamics, the complexities of friendship, and the enduring power of redemption, offering a mature and emotionally resonant experience for viewers.

Comparing and Contrasting the Two

While Cobra Kai builds upon the foundation laid by The Karate Kid, there are key differences:

  • Themes and Messages: Both explore themes of perseverance and self-discovery, but Cobra Kai adds layers of complexity by examining the lasting consequences of past actions and the complexities of redemption.
  • Character Development: While the original films focused on Daniel's journey, Cobra Kai provides a more balanced perspective, exploring the motivations and backstories of both Daniel and Johnny in greater depth.
  • Evolution of Martial Arts Styles: The show showcases both Miyagi-Do karate and Cobra Kai's aggressive style, highlighting the contrasting philosophies and their impact on the characters.
